
Warwick Levy, who runs Lonely Kids Club, says AI may have been used to scrape his entire website and replicate designsGet our breaking news email, free app or daily news podcastAfter 15 years running a small business making T-shirts, Warwick Levy says it was “brutal” when he first discovered an identical design for sale on Temu.It turned out there was an overwhelming amount of T-shirts identical to his own for sale on the Chinese e-commerce marketplace.
